Least Common Multiple of 61493 and 61501 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 61493 and 61501,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(61493,61501) = 1
LCM(61493,61501) = ( 61493 × 61501) / 1
LCM(61493,61501) = 3781880993 / 1
LCM(61493,61501) = 3781880993
